Julie was educated in the parochial school system in Mobile, AL and attended Mercy High School and Bishop Toolen in Mobile and Marymount in Rome, Italy. She graduated from Mastin School of Nursing and worked in various areas of nursing, especially oncology, throughout her nursing career. She was a graduate of the inaugural class of Physician Assistants receiving her Master’s degree for the University of South Alabama and worked as certified physician’s assistant in Mobile and, later, at Winship Cancer Institute of Emory University in Atlanta. She was a very dedicated mid-level provider and was recognized for the compassionate care she gave to all her patients.
Julie was an avid reader, especially, of history and religion. She was very active in her church and held deep interest in spiritual living as well as alternative methods of healing.
